     30 #include <cutils/properties.h>
     31 #ifndef __THERMAL_CLIENT_H__
     32 #define __THERMAL_CLIENT_H__
     33 
     34 #ifdef __cplusplus
     35 extern "C" {
     36 #endif
     37 
     38 #define MAX_ACTIONS  (32)
     39 
     40 /* Enum for supported fields */
     41 enum supported_fields {
     42 	UNKNOWN_FIELD = 0x0,
     43 	DISABLE_FIELD = 0x1,
     44 	SAMPLING_FIELD = 0x2,
     45 	THRESHOLDS_FIELD = 0x4,
     46 	SET_POINT_FIELD = THRESHOLDS_FIELD,
     47 	THRESHOLDS_CLR_FIELD = 0x8,
     48 	SET_POINT_CLR_FIELD = THRESHOLDS_CLR_FIELD,
     49 	ACTION_INFO_FIELD = 0x10,
     50 	SUPPORTED_FIELD_MAX = 0x20,
     51 };
     52 
     53 enum field_data_type {
     54 	FIELD_INT = 0,
     55 	FIELD_STR,
     56 	FIELD_INT_ARR,
     57 	FIELD_ARR_STR,
     58 	FIELD_ARR_INT_ARR,
     59 	FIELD_MAX
     60 };
     61 
     62 struct action_info_data {
     63 	int info[MAX_ACTIONS];
     64 	uint32_t num_actions;
     65 };
     66 
     67 struct field_data {
     68 	char *field_name;
     69 	enum field_data_type data_type;
     70 	uint32_t num_data;
     71 	void *data;
     72 };
     73 
     74 struct config_instance {
     75 	char *cfg_desc;
     76 	char *algo_type;
     77 	unsigned int fields_mask;  /* mask set by client to request to adjust supported fields */
     78 	uint32_t num_fields;
     79 	struct field_data *fields;
     80 };
     81 
     82 int thermal_client_config_query(char *algo_type, struct config_instance **configs);
     83 void thermal_client_config_cleanup(struct config_instance *configs, unsigned int config_size);
     84 int thermal_client_config_set(struct config_instance *configs, unsigned int config_size);
     85 
     86 int thermal_client_register_callback(char *client_name, int (*callback)(int , void *, void *), void *data);
     87 int thermal_client_request(char *client_name, int req_data);
     88 void thermal_client_unregister_callback(int client_cb_handle);
     89 
     90 #ifdef __cplusplus
     91 }
     92 #endif
     93 
     94 #endif /* __THERMAL_CLIENT_H__ */
